Title:Description:A slide presentation depicting the country and people of Korea. From a children's lecture written by Rev. Archibald W. Campbell: "I often follow Grandpa over the stepping stones with a basket of clothes on my head. Boys and men carry their loads on their backs like the boy in front of Grandpa. A workman behind me is getting his load of cabbage ready to carry on his back."Creator:Campbell, Archibald, 1890-1977. (artist)Subject names:Presbyterian Church in the U.S.A. Title:Description:A slide presentation depicting the country and people of Korea. From a children's lecture written by Rev. Archibald W. Campbell: "Then at night, mamma irons clothes by beating them with little clubs on a slab of marble. In the case are silk-covered quilts for guests - or just for show. Clothes are kept in the red chests."Creator:Campbell, Archibald, 1890-1977. (artist)Subject names:Presbyterian Church in the U.S.A.
